The transcript covers discussions on the President's budget and tax plans, focusing on infrastructure investment and tax policy changes, including capital gains. It also explores shareholder activism, particularly in relation to Exxon, and the importance of ESG in corporate governance. The conversation shifts to diversity and inclusion in business, highlighting efforts to promote diverse leadership and the challenges faced in achieving gender equality.
